AI Summary
-
Establishes an investigative unit within the office of the auditor to conduct investigations involving alleged or suspected government waste, fraud, abuse, nonfeasance, or malfeasance.
-
Investigations may be initiated by: a concurrent resolution adopted by the legislature; a request from a standing committee chair with concurrence of both the senate president and house speaker; an act of the legislature; or the auditor with concurrence of both the senate president and house speaker.
-
Authorizes the auditor to consider information from postaudits and examinations when determining whether to initiate an investigation under the auditor's own authority.
-
Amends Hawaii Revised Statutes Section 23-4 to add the investigative duties to the auditor's existing postaudit responsibilities.
-
Takes effect upon approval.
